[PATCH] libata-dev: Let ata_hsm_move() work with both irq-pio and polling pio



Let ata_hsm_move() work with both irq-pio and polling pio codepath.

Changes:
- add a new parameter "in_wq" for polling pio
- add return value "poll_next" to tell polling pio task whether the HSM is finished
- merge code from ata_pio_first_block() to the HSM_ST_FIRST state.
- call ata_poll_qc_complete() if called from the workqueue
